The period of troubled times can be briefly described as decline. This era went down in history as the years of natural disasters, the crisis - economic and state - the intervention of foreigners. This stagnation lasted from 1598 to 1612.
Time of Troubles in Russia: briefly on the main thing
The beginning of the unrest was marked by the suppression of the Rurik dynasty: the legitimate heirs of Ivan the Terrible died, in Russia there was no legitimate king. By the way, the death of the last heir to the throne was very mysterious. She is still shrouded in secrets. The struggle for power began in the country, accompanied by intrigue. Until 1605, Boris Godunov sat on the throne, on whose board famine fell. Lack of food forces people to engage in robbery and robbery. The revolt of Khlop ended the discontent of the masses, who lived in the hope that the prince Dmitry killed by Godunov was alive and would soon restore order.
So, the reasons for troubled times are outlined. What came next? As expected, False Dmitry I appeared, who obtained support from the Poles. During the war with the impostor, Tsar Boris Godunov and his son Fedor die. However, the unworthy throne was not long: the people overthrew False Dmitry I and elected Vasily Shuisky as king.
But the rule of the new king was also in the spirit of troubled times. Briefly, this period can be described as follows: during the uprising of Ivan Bolotnikov, False Dmitry II appeared , for the struggle against which the tsar signs an agreement with Sweden. However, such an alliance did more harm than good. The king was removed from the throne, and the boyars began to rule the country. As a result of the Semiboyarshchyna, the Poles entered the capital and began to instill the Catholic faith, while plundering everything around. Which further exacerbated the already difficult situation of ordinary people.
However, despite all the hardships and deprivations of the troubled times (briefly described as the most terrible era for our country), Mother Russia found the strength for the birth of heroes. They prevented the disappearance of Russia on the world map. We are talking about Lyapunov’s militia: the Novgorodians Dmitry Pozharsky and Kuzma Minin gathered people and drove out foreign invaders from their native land. After this, the Zemsky Sobor was held, during which Mikhail Fedorovich Romanov was elected to the kingdom. This event ended the most difficult period in the history of Russia. The throne was occupied by the new ruling dynasty, which was overthrown by the Communists only at the beginning of the twentieth century. The Romanov House brought the country out of darkness and strengthened its position on the world stage.
The consequences of troubled times. Briefly
The results of the troubles for Russia are very deplorable. As a result of chaos, the country lost a significant part of its territory, suffered significant losses in population. The economy was in terrible decline, the people became weak and lost hope. However, what does not kill makes you stronger. So the Russian people managed to find the strength in themselves to once again restore their rights and make themselves known to the whole world. Having survived the most difficult times, Russia was reborn. Crafts, culture began to develop, people returned to agriculture and cattle breeding, stopping robberies on the high road.
